The Wisdom of Spiritual Goal-Setting
This sermon, titled “The Wisdom of Spiritual Goal-Setting,” focuses on how believers can prepare for the new year by setting meaningful spiritual goals. It begins by emphasizing the importance of aligning our plans with God’s purpose, as Proverbs 16:3 instructs us to “commit your work to the Lord.” By entrusting our plans to God through prayer and Scripture, we allow His wisdom to shape our direction, ensuring our goals reflect His will and glorify Him. The second key point highlights striving for Christlike maturity, drawing from Philippians 3:12-14. Spiritual growth is presented as a lifelong journey that requires intentionality, effort, and reliance on God’s strength. Believers are encouraged to set specific goals for personal growth, such as deepening their prayer life or engaging in service, and to reflect on areas where they can develop Christlike character. Finally, the sermon underscores the need for perseverance in pursuing spiritual goals. Drawing again from Philippians, it encourages believers to press forward with resilience, trusting God to provide strength in the face of challenges. Through perseverance, believers can overcome distractions and obstacles, pressing toward the prize of Christlikeness. Together, these principles form a practical and inspiring guide for entering the new year with purpose, faith, and a commitment to grow closer to God.
